Basketball is one of the most attended and exciting winter sports. Among the varsity team, Senior, Brayden Eskandari is one of the teams star players. Brayden has been “playing basketball [since] middle school” and has a passion for the sport. This year he played as center; so he has to be “able to get rebounds” and make sure his team scores. Like most sports, basketball has grueling practices that consist of “warm-ups, drills for shooting, defense, ball handling, and after that [they run] plays and scrimmages”. What keeps Brayden playing is the “adrenaline rush [he gets] during games”. When the score is close the gym erupts with noise from students, teachers, players, and parents, making it a truly exciting event you will never forget. Brayden also loves the bond he gets with the other boys on the team “as its not just about what happens on the court”. He said they hang outside of school a lot and it shows in the chemistry they have on the court. Outside of basketball Brayden also plays golf and was on the fall team for Sunlake. Brayden’s advice for people looking to make the basketball team would be to “communicate [on and off the court] and build trust [with your teamates].
